Great opportunity for lions

Sitting firmly in the driver’s seat to book tickets for the famous Champions League, Athletic Bilbao solidified the spot this season as one of Spain’s real surprise packages.

Ernesto Valverde’s team, who booked the Europa League final four spots against the Rangers on April 17th and claimed a 2-0 victory over the Rangers, found the mood at red-hot heights at camp.

Despite suffering from a final heartbreak at Spanish icon Real Madrid on April 20th, the host on Thursday insisted on an immediate response from the previous episode.

Collecting a 1-0 victory over Las Palmas, Bilbao has won three of his previous four appearances in all competitions, bringing his only loss from one of his last 10 consecutive outings.

Similarly, it should be noted that in addition to winning the final three consecutive matchups at San Mames 6-1, Valverde’s camp has not had a single defeat in the Basque Country since mid-January.

Pressure remains on the shoulder of Amorim

Manchester United may have booked the Europa League semi-final spot two weeks ago following their iconic comeback with Lyon at Old Trafford, but the pressure still remains firmly on Amorim’s shoulders.

Despite taking a final 1-1 stalemate at Bournemouth last weekend, United have broken a string of unwanted records this season, sitting firmly in the lower half of the Premier League table.

There are plenty of sections around Old Trafford, who has lost much faith with the former sports Lisbon boss, as fans around Manchester’s Red Half reveal their frustration in abundance.

United have gained a reputation for obvious issues on the road, as they did not win any of their past seven consecutive appearances across all competitions within 90 minutes.

In fact, Amorim’s downbeat team recorded its only victory from Old Trafford since the end of January.
